IRISO is a leading company in Board to Board Connectors.
In particular, we boast the greatest variation in the industry for Floating Connector, in which the connecting surfaces Floating during Mating. The Floating Connector absorbs board misalignment and reduces stress on soldering parts. Prevents soldering cracks. It is also possible to mount and mate multiple Mating on the same board. We will respond to customer needs with a wide variety of variations.

In addition to Floating the X-axis and Y-axis, we also released the "Z-Move structure ™" connector, which allows the Z-axis to Floating while the contacts are fixed. Capable of absorbing minute substrate amplitude due to resonance in the high vibration frequency range. Until now, it was thought that FPC/FFC cards could not be assembled by robots.
In the case of FPC / FFC Connectors Mating, it is necessary to lock the slider cover, so the usual process is to use both hands. In addition, it was difficult to understand even if oblique insertion or incomplete Mating occurred. For this reason, an inspection process is required to ensure that it is always properly locked.
IRISO 's FPC / FFC Connectors Auto I-Lock structure automatically locks when an FPC/FFC card is inserted, ensuring secure Mating. Robot assembly is possible even when using FPC/FFC cards.

"2-Point Contact structure" is a concept that has two contact structures on the same line. Stable contact is guaranteed with the ability to remove foreign matter such as floating matter and scattered flux, and reliable wiping.
In addition, even if one of the terminal contacts gets on the deposit, one terminal of the 2-Point Contact structure is reliably conducted to prevent contact failure.
By adopting a 2-Point Contact structure, contact reliability is improved, which improves yield and contributes to total cost reduction.
